I'm not sure about the TKTS question, but my guess would be that both TLM and August will be up on TKTS, especially during the slow time. There's probably more of a chance of August being there than Mermaid.

For Wicked, the best partial view seats are the ones further back because they are least obstructed. Rows G and H (seats 25, 27, 26, 28, I believe) are great.
